Extended Description
LGPV4400W Eaton: Eaton PV Guard / Solar complete molded case circuit breaker, LG-frame, LG, Complete breaker, Fixed thermal, fixed magnetic trip type, Four-pole, 400A, 1000 Vdc, 7.5 kAIC, Without terminals, Photo voltaic, 80% rated

FAQs
The LGPV4400W uses the LG frame and is designed as a complete four-pole MCCB, enabling straightforward integration into LG-frame panel assemblies and standard electrical rooms. With no terminals included, installers can select compatible lugs or terminal kits to meet wiring methods and insulation requirements, reducing field modifications and delivering clean, compliant terminations in solar projects.
The LGPV4400W is UL Listed and CSA Certified, with a photovoltaic class designation to address DC PV protections. These certifications support NEC 690 compliance, utility interconnection requirements, and broader safety approvals for solar installations, simplifying procurement, inspection, and commissioning processes.
The device features a fixed thermal, fixed magnetic trip known as T186, designed for reliable coordination and fast fault clearance. It provides an interrupt rating of 7.5 kAIC, enabling effective interruption of short-circuit currents in 400 A, 1000 Vdc PV circuits and enhancing overall system safety.
Yes. The LGPV4400W is specified for 1000 Vdc operation, with an 80% rating suitable for PV applications. Its four-pole LG frame and PV-class construction are tailored for solar arrays, inverters, and PV combiner boxes, offering robust overcurrent protection in utility-scale and commercial PV deployments.
Because terminals are not included, you should plan for compatible lugs or terminal adapters and ensure wiring methods meet local code and insulation requirements. Verify torque, conductor sizing, and enclosure fit for the 15 in x 9 in x 8 in footprint and the 18 lb weight to optimize handling, spacing, and thermal management in rooftop or rack-mounted PV installations.
